Join Jemima in her Masters recital as she explores the themes of love, loss and the inevitability of fate through an exciting programme of Bellini, Berlioz, Strauss, Bizet, Vaughan Williams, Howells and Parry.
Follow her on a journey through a forest at lovers meeting, stand beside Romeo as he fights for his Juliet, weep with Strauss at the loss of a lifelong love and reminisce on the melancholic beauty of all that is left behind. From the ecstatic joy of newfound passion to the quiet devastation of parting, this programme traces the fragile threads that bind love and grief so closely together.
Through moments of aching tenderness, longing and remembrance, Fated Hearts and Faded Echoes invites audiences into a world where love lingers long after the final farewell, and where every ending leaves behind its own echo.
